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Chinquapin Park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Chinquapin Park?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Chinquapin Park is at Stratford Apartments listed at $910.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Chinquapin Park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Chinquapin Park is $1,218.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Chinquapin Park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Chinquapin Park is a 1,115 square feet unit starting from $1,160 at Renaissance Club.

What is the average size for Chinquapin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Chinquapin Park is currently at 591 sq ft.
